Town Board — January 13, 2022

Summarized from the meeting minutes. Refer to the official documents below for the authoritative record.

The Nunda Township Board of Trustees met on January 13, 2022, approving prior meeting minutes and warrants for both the Township and Road District. Reports covered the Monarch Pledge request, leaf pickup, a denied TORMA legal fee claim, winter road readiness, and COVID/flu safety reminders. There was no new or old business, and the meeting adjourned quickly.

  6. Reports by Supervisor, Town Clerk, Highway Commissioner, Assessor and Trustees

    Supervisor Bobera-Drain discussed a resident's request to support the Mayors Monarch Pledge, thanked the Road Commissioner for leaf pickup help, and noted TORMA declined to pay a legal fee claim from a recent lawsuit. The Road Commissioner reported plow trucks are ready for winter and summer equipment is being prepared. Trustee Parrish urged continued COVID/flu safety and checking on neighbors. Assessor Dzemske provided the Monthly Meeting Report for review.
